Output 84db3ddcc63bee557661a527690b10217806c5942c8f22a203ca7cdc3e01456f:1

value
108720395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da041d3f5a1bac816d842053b1f329d9aea548a4 OP_EQUAL
address
3MZnAE3ekN4UtkUbWWzFiqZQgsWsDmg4Wc
transaction
84db3ddcc63bee557661a527690b10217806c5942c8f22a203ca7cdc3e01456f
spent
true